Link Oregon is a federally tax exempt, Oregon non-profit organization that supports the diverse research, education, health care, and public service missions of its five founding entities – Oregon Health & Science University (OHSU), Oregon State University (OSU), Portland State University (PSU), the University of Oregon (UO), and the State of Oregon (through the Enterprise Information Services function) – and other members in the public and non-profit sectors within Oregon. Link Oregon is a membership consortium operating a statewide, facilities-based broadband network that consists of over 2,500 route-miles of lit optical fiber, a modern optronics platform with over 30 attachment locations, an Ethernet transport platform, and an enhanced Internet service offering connectivity to the commodity Internet, local peering, direct cloud connects, and advanced research networks such as Internet2 and CENIC. In addition, Link Oregon provides cybersecurity and other collaborative IT services to its members. Link Oregon is governed by a strategic Board of Directors consisting of representatives of the founding entities and other public organizations.

We are seeking a Membership Development Lead to join our team and play a vital role in growing and sustaining our public and non-profit membership base within the state of Oregon. Members in Link Oregon would be considered customers in the commercial sector. The Membership Development Lead contributes ideas and subject matter expertise in the field of member relationship management and business development. They are responsible for developing and executing strategies to attract, engage, and retain members; developing and maintaining cross-team workflows and standardized processes; and ultimately contributing to the financial stability and success of our organization. The incumbent will report directly to OSU’s Executive Director for Digital Extension and Engagement, while structurally reporting to the Link Oregon Executive Director.
